What Ofsted said

From the inspection on 1 April 2025

This is a school that puts pupils at the heart of all it does. The three values of trust, respect and love are the central themes that run through every aspect of its work. Relationships are based on these. Pupils forge strong and purposeful relationships with adults. They also form meaningful relationships with their peers. Pupils intuitively look out for each other at social times. All of this helps pupils to feel safe in school. The school is determined that all pupils reach their full potential. This ambition is realised, and pupils achieve very well. This is demonstrated in how well they succeed with their education, but it extends beyond that. The school is also resolute in its ambition that each pupil leaves knowing they can play a positive part in society. Pupils already demonstrate ways in which they are active citizens who want to make a difference, and they do so. Pupils' behaviour is exceptional. They are polite and courteous at all times. The genuine respect and care pupils have for each other is inspiring. As well as this, they have excellent attitudes in lessons. They want to learn and engage well with the learning opportunities provided.

What the school should improve

  • In some subjects, the school has not clarified precisely the essential knowledge that pupils need to know and remember. This affects how well some pupils build on prior learning and deepen understanding over time. The school should identify the key knowledge that is vital for future success within each topic and for each subject area.
  • The school has not determined how it will assess pupils' ongoing understanding. This is both during lessons and at the end of a topic. As a result, sometimes, key gaps in pupils' understanding are not addressed effectively enough. The school should continue to develop an agreed system for checking understanding so staff can respond to gaps in learning or misunderstandings without delay.
